THack @ Seattle is open to developers and web designers who dream about building digital things to help travelers on their journeys.
We have co-working space for up to 100 developers who will compete for more than $3,000 in cash and other prizes.
Developers will pick one (or more) of these four challenges and build a working product over the weekend of April 18-19:
- Inspiration, discovery and memories – Create an application that helps travelers decide where to go and how to share their journey and experiences.
- Local concierge – Make a product that explores options for tours, activities and services in-destination.
- Accommodation finder – Hotel? Hostel? Home-share? Build a recommendation engine for personalized accommodations.
- Route planner – Create and application for transportation choices that are time-efficient, cost-effective or creatively scenic ... or all three.
Participants must submit a working prototype created for THack @ Seattle, such as mobile apps, web-based applications or other software-based products or services.
